Chamber Arts Series

Now celebrating its 80th year, this popular series features eight concerts by world-renowned small ensembles selected by the Chamber Arts Society of Durham at Duke University.

Akropolis Reed Quintet

Akropolis Reed Quintet

Friday, January 23 at 7:30pm

Described by BBC Music Magazine as a ‘sonically daring ensemble’, the Akropolis Reed Quintet has commissioned more than 150 new works by living composers for their distinctive instrumentation: oboe, clarinet, bass clarinet, saxophone, and bassoon. This program pairs exciting new works with arrangements of Gershwin and Ravel.

Manhattan Chamber Players

Manhattan Chamber Players

Sunday, March 8 at 7:00pm

Manhattan Chamber Players bring together accomplished soloists and ensemble musicians, combining their talents in a flexible line-up that brings fresh vitality to chamber music. They present a pair of piano quintets by Weinberg and Brahms.

Doric String Quartet

Doric String Quartet

Friday, March 27 at 7:30pm

Praised for their ‘sumptuous sweetness and laser-like clarity’ (BBC Music Magazine), Doric String Quartet has earned international acclaim. Tracing a lineage of musical invention, the quartet’s program spans the work of Bach, Haydn, and Beethoven.
